    4.0.3 Hunter pets live forever- Bug

    This is something I've noticed since 4.0.3 in reaction to Blizzard trying to fix the problem where hunter pets are summoned with roughly 20% of their total health randomly.

    Basically, while your pet is fighting, every 5-10 seconds, it will heal itself up to about 80% of its total health for no reason. This heal is not recorded in the combat log and it doesn't appear as green text over the pet.
    As the video shows, while my pet is on passive, the heals don't happen, and after the fight with Anzu, the worm doesn't recover anymore either.



    This has been unbelievably useful for soloing various things.

    Have fun, hunters

    EDIT: One important detail, at no point during filming did I use mend pet OR the spirit beast's heal. So don't think that happened.

    I believe this bug is caused by your pet scaling to your stamina after it is summoned. The lower HP pool you see is most likely your pets HP before applying your stamina to his health, then after a second or two the game calculates all your stats into the equation..it would be kinda unfair if your pet only started at like 5k hp everytime you summon him, so the game heals it for you.

    I just tested my method and confirmed it.
    Call your pet, and get him into combat ASAP before the stamina scaling starts.

    It's as easy as that. If you do this, your pet will keep getting healed.

    I was having limited success with my current pets, and they all had Bloodthirsty, either 2/2 or 1/2. I abandoned one and tamed a Wind Serpent inside Sethekk Halls - specced him up, then he proceeded to solo the rest of the instance, with myself only using an arcane shot for credit on bosses. I'll test some more, but it seems that this bug does not happen while specced into Bloodthirsty.
